My other key works fine. Can these keys loose programming?




However, these keys use induction, i.e. do not require battery to communicate with the ignition. You can take the batteries from your working key fob and it will still start your car. Batteries are opening the doors, and communicate with keyless go.
Can the be repaired? Not an expert on it. Did your keyfob fall on the ground, or got wet. If the inductive coil inside got damage, the key is a paper weight. In the meantime, careful with the working key.
